Cost Breakdown of Dental Implants
Oral implants are typically viewed as a costs tooth substitute alternative, and understanding their expense can assist you make an informed choice.
The overall price of oral implants differs based upon a number of factors, including the complexity of your instance, the number of implants required, and the area of the oral method.
On average, you could anticipate to pay between $3,000 and $4,500 per implant. Highly recommended Internet site includes the implant itself, the abutment (the connector item), and the crown that sits on top.
However, added costs can occur. As an example, if you need bone grafts or sinus lifts to guarantee correct positioning, these treatments can add anywhere from $300 to $3,000 to your general costs.
Don't ignore the first assessment and imaging, which may vary from $100 to $500, relying on the diagnostic tools used.
Additionally, bear in mind to consider possible follow-up visits and maintenance. By breaking down these costs, you'll obtain a more clear picture of the financial dedication associated with picking dental implants, helping you consider your choices better.
Lasting Costs of Alternatives
Checking out tooth substitute options often reveals that alternatives to oral implants can lead to substantial long-term expenses.
While alternatives like dentures or bridges may seem more affordable upfront, they typically include concealed costs that can build up in time.
For example, dentures need regular changes and replacements, generally every five to seven years. Each adjustment adds to your overall expense, not to mention the potential for repairs if they become harmed.
In a similar way, bridges rely on the health of surrounding teeth. If children's dentist fall short or become jeopardized, you might need extra treatments, boosting your costs.
Additionally, take into consideration the impact on your dental health. Dentures can trigger bone loss in your jaw gradually, bring about even more dental problems and extra therapies.
Bridges may additionally require root canals or various other treatments if issues emerge.
In contrast, oral implants, however originally more expensive, usually save you cash over time by eliminating the requirement for constant substitutes and minimizing added dental concerns.
